Become a $10 member →This is the 2nd solo example following previous Fmaj7 Bm7b5 E7 progression. This time it's Fmaj7 Cm7 Bbmaj7.
This chord progression is super common II V to IV. There's an example of Fmaj7 Bm7b5 E7 Fmaj7 Cm7 F7 to Bbmaj7 at the end to show how these lines can be connected together from the top of the song.
I recommend to find out more lines in different positions, work on few bars like this then try from the beginning.
